Back in the day, if you wanted a ride home from college for the holidays, you’d slap up your request up on a bulletin board somewhere around campus or check that same billboard for those already heading in your direction. That’s “so yesterday” as one Disney pop starlet used to sing. Now, we have Web2.0-friendly PickupPal.

Hmm. Let’s see. PickupPal. What does that say to you? Does it say come pick up a pal to ride home with you for the holidays? Or does it say check out the latest “pals” we have for you to “pick up,” use your PayPal account to “purchase” them and look forward to the best sex you’ve ever had in a moving vehicle. You decide.
